| | 2,3,6-Trimethoxyamphetamine (hydrochloride) Usage And Synthesis |
| Description | 2,3,6-Trimethoxyamphetamine (hydrochloride) (Item No. 26492) is an analytical reference standard categorized as an amphetamine. 2,3,6-Trimethoxyamphetamine has hallucinogenic properties. This product is intended for research and forensic applications. | | Uses | 2,3,6-Trimethoxyamphetamine hydrochloride is an amphetamine[1]. | | References | [1] Shevyrin V, et al.
